The Minister of Defence and Veteran Affairs Hon. Vincent Ssempijja has hosted a delegation from National Service Projects Organisations (NSPO) of Egypt at the Ministry of Defence and Veteran Affairs (MODVA) Headquarters in Mbuya.
The NSPO in Egypt is an equivalent of the National Enterprise Corporation (NEC) in Uganda.
The closed-door meeting discussed issues of mutual interest between the two countries at the MoDVA headquarters in Kampala.
The Minister of Defence and Veteran Affairs was accompanied by; Under Secretary Finance at MoDVA Ms. Edith Butuuro, UPDF MP and Chief Executive Officer of NEC Lt Gen James Mugira among other senior officers.
The delegation was led by Brig Gen Ahmed Ahmed Muhamed who was accompanied by the Defence Attaché to Uganda Brig Gen Hany Hassanin Ahmed.
Other members of the NSPO delegation included: Col Mohamed Tarex Mohamed, Col Alsayed Mohamed Abdel and Lt Col Elnaggar Abdelmuhny.
